noun
- the process or act of setting type using a Linotype machine
Usage: historical; printing industry
verb
- to set type or compose text using a Linotype machine
Usage: historical; printing industry
Examples
- Linotyping was the dominant method of newspaper composition throughout the twentieth century.
- The printer spent his career linotyping for the local newspaper.
- Before digital printing, linotyping required skilled operators who could work quickly and accurately.
- The newspaper's linotyping department operated around the clock to meet daily deadlines.
- Modern journalism has largely replaced linotyping with computer-based typesetting systems.
